Weihong Jiang is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ine and Surgery. According to data from OpenAlex, Weihong Jiang has authored 58 papers receiving a total of 1.5k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 25 papers in Molecular Biology, 12 papers in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ine and 7 papers in Surgery. Recurrent topics in Weihong Jiang's work include Microbial metabolism and enzyme function (9 papers), Blood Pressure and Hypertension Studies (6 papers) and Microbial Natural Products and Biosynthesis (5 papers). Weihong Jiang is often cited by papers focused on Microbial metabolism and enzyme function (9 papers), Blood Pressure and Hypertension Studies (6 papers) and Microbial Natural Products and Biosynthesis (5 papers). Weihong Jiang collaborates with scholars based in China, United States and United Kingdom. Weihong Jiang's co-authors include Barry L. Wanner, William W. Metcalf, Andreas Haldimann, Soo-Ki Kim, Larry L. Daniels, Christi J. Wylie, Jessica K. Lerch, Evan S. Deneris, Michael M. Scott and Stefan Herlitze and has published in prestigious journals such as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, Journal of Biological Chemistry and Energy & Environmental Science.
